## Service Accounts: SplitBranch Assignment Service

Heads up for reviewers: SplitBranch (our A/B assignment service) runs under the `svc-splitbranch` account, which can only read experiment configs and write assignment logs — nothing else, so don't approve PRs that widen that scope. Local integration tests hit the internal staging endpoint instead of prod. For those tests, the service authenticates with the key below.

API key for tagug-tajef: vxb4-R1fo

## Handover: Ledgerline API pagination

Taking over from me on Ledgerline's public REST API. Cursor pagination shipped last sprint; offset mode stays as a deprecated fallback until the next major release. Known issue: cursors expire faster than documented under heavy load, tracked separately. Rate limits are unchanged. For release sign-off, verify the gateway and the docs agree on page-size bounds before you cut the tag. The pagination behavior is driven entirely by the configuration values shown here.

service settings:
[ulair]
team = praath
access_code = ac_06d704
owner = wenix.ulair
host = ulair.qirvancorp.corp
port = 9200
peer = sorys.nelvronet.internal
salt = 2668132c
pin = 9140

## Changed Defaults: Bulk Edits in Admin Table

As of release 4.2, bulk edits in the Rostervane admin table are disabled by default and must be explicitly enabled per role. Previously, any admin session could select and mutate up to 500 rows; the new default cap is 50, with every bulk action written to the audit stream before commit. The enforcing middleware reads its limits from the service environment, with current values as follows.

deployment values, kahof-yadug:
[gorys]
team = silael
access_code = ac_00d620
owner = istox.oliys
host = gorys.torvastack.example
port = 9000
peer = holmir.merlaqsoft.example
salt = 9fdae78a
pin = 2358

This alert fires when a tenant exceeds its per-tenant rate quota on the Quillgate API tier by more than 150% over a five-minute window. Sustained breaches may indicate credential misuse, a runaway client, or a misconfigured quota override. The enforcement layer throttles automatically, so availability impact to other tenants should be nil; the security concern is the source of the excess traffic. Review the tenant's recent override history and request signatures. Investigation steps and quota-change audit procedures are documented here.

wiki page, tahaf-tajog: https://jira.ordindyn.corp/pipeline